I am very pleased to announce the release of my good friend Clint Heidorn's debut full length LP titled "Atwater".

These are quite beautiful compositions made from acoustic guitars, cellos, violins, field recordings, sporadic percussion, and a variety of other devices to create an old vintage "antiquarian" feel. Like finding an old book in the corner of your dirty, cobwebbed attic that is filled with stories of depression and sadness, yet hope and beauty, that only falls apart and turns to dust the more pages in you turn.

I am bad with comparisons, but maybe it is reminiscent of some of the newer sounds of Earth or maybe the quieter parts of Godspeed you Black Emperor!

This release is more of a passionate art-object than some half-assed, sloppily put together album some people seem to be churning out on a conveyor belt lately. I can definitely see this album put up on shelves or walls on display to the world, rather than stuffed haphazardly inside your run of the mill record storage receptacle. Hopefully you will fall into the first group and be one of the lucky few to own one the mere 148 copies produced of this masterwork.

Hand-stained, hand-numbered, and hand-silkscreened, including hand-affixed bones of local trees. Includes a photograph and album credit insert printed on 80# linen card stock, and a download code.
